    LADIES Draggin jeans

    Well, I've read allot of the 'draggin jeans' threads and DH and I have pretty much come to the conclusion we'll be buying a pair. However, instead of buying from the USA site, I would like to buy from the AU site as there is a greater selection.

    So, question is for the ladies, what do you think of their styles? Do they fit well? The US site only shows men-type cuts and 'mom style' jeans. I'm 5'3" 110 and in shape. I don't want to be cramped, but I want to look good! I like boot cut, but NOT flare leg.

    I'm looking at the Traffic style, I want the amor in the knees too.

    A friend and I were in motomail this week and tried on the new bootcut ladies dragon jeans (sorry don't know the style name). She's a size 10 and the size 10 dragons fit her well and looked hot. I'm just under 5'3 and am a size 7, I tried the size 6 dragons and they were pretty naff to be honest. They didn't fit well through the hips (too big, material was baggy). Good luck with your order, i'd be keen to hear how they fit when you get em.

    I went to Leather Direct in Cuba st on Friday and got a pair of the Urban Camo draggins (thanks for the tip Mrs Kendog!). My intention was to try them on then mail order the correct size more cheaply but once I'd put them on I loved them so much I had to buy them then and there, they're really comfy and they look like ordinary old street camo pants (with a bit higher waist of course, we all know exposed flesh is not a plus when riding). I've previously tried women's draggins on and they looked hideous so it was a nice surprise that these ones fit so well.
